Benton woman arrested for attempted first-degree murder after juvenile hit her parked vehicle

According to Benton police, officers were collecting statements when the 24-year-old woman attempted to run over the juvenile driver who hit her parked vehicle.

BENTON, Ark. — The Benton Police Department arrested a 24-year-old woman after she tried to run over a juvenile who hit her parked vehicle at a private property off Interstate 30 around 6:45 p.m. Friday.

Benton police said Daisha McCuien of Benton, the owner of the hit vehicle, attempted to kill the juvenile driver when officers were collecting statements.

McCuien was charged with attempted first-degree murder, four counts of aggravated assault, first-degree battery, four counts of endangering the welfare of a minor in the first degree and reckless driving.

The juvenile was taken to the hospital and is expected to recover.
